Analysis
The most recent figure for pulses, total — production, per unit of gdp in Switzerland is 0 t per US$ of GDP, measured in 2024.
Compared with earlier readings it is down 1.0% on the previous year and down 60.3% over ten years.
Over the whole period, pulses, total — production, per unit of gdp in Switzerland peaked at 0 t per US$ of GDP in 1974 and was at its lowest, 0 t per US$ of GDP, in 1961.
That places Switzerland 147th out of 151 countries with data for 2024, putting it in the bottom quarter.
The series is highly variable year to year, so single readings are best treated with caution.

How this figure is calculated
Pulses, Total — Production divided by GDP (current US$), matched on country and year. Neither publisher issues this ratio as a series; it is computed here from both.
Pulses, Total — Production ÷ GDP (current US$)
Computed from
- Pulses, Total — Production Food and Agriculture Organization of the United Nations
- GDP Country official statistics, National Statistical Organizations and/or Central Banks
Statizoid computes this series; the underlying measurements belong to the publishers named above. The arithmetic is applied to every country and year where both inputs report, and nothing is estimated unless the page says so.
